front cover of Heatstroke
Heatstroke
Nature in an Age of Global Warming
Anthony D. Barnosky
Island Press, 2010
In 2006, one of the hottest years on record, a “pizzly” was discovered near the top of the world. Half polar bear, half grizzly, this never-before-seen animal might be dismissed as a fluke of nature. Anthony Barnosky instead sees it as a harbinger of things to come.

In Heatstroke, the renowned paleoecologist shows how global warming is fundamentally changing the natural world and its creatures. While melting ice may have helped produce the pizzly, climate change is more likely to wipe out species than to create them. Plants and animals that have followed the same rhythms for millennia are suddenly being confronted with a world they’re unprepared for—and adaptation usually isn’t an option.

This is not the first time climate change has dramatically transformed Earth. Barnosky draws connections between the coming centuries and the end of the last ice age, when mass extinctions swept the planet. The differences now are that climate change is faster and hotter than past changes, and for the first time humanity is driving it. Which means this time we can work to stop it.

No one knows exactly what nature will come to look like in this new age of global warming. But Heatstroke gives us a haunting portrait of what we stand to lose and the vitality of what can be saved.

front cover of The Hidden Universe
The Hidden Universe
Adventures in Biodiversity
Alexandre Antonelli
University of Chicago Press, 2022
An unforgettable exploration of the natural world and the concept of biodiversity—what it is, why it matters, and how we as individuals can work to preserve it.
 
We are now living in an environmental emergency. As climate change, habitat loss, and other threats have placed almost one-fifth of all species on Earth at risk of extinction in the coming decades, a deeper understanding of biodiversity has never been more important. Biodiversity encompasses the rich variety of all life on Earth—the building blocks of life that provide invaluable sources of food, medicine, clothing, building materials, and more.

Marking the arrival of a bold new voice in popular science, The Hidden Universe shows readers what’s at stake in the fight to protect and restore biodiversity, but also what can and should be done now to protect our planet and ourselves for the future. As director of science at one of the world’s largest research organizations in plant and fungal sciences, Brazilian-born scientist Alexandre Antonelli is ideally suited to reveal the wonders of biodiversity at a genetic, species, and ecosystem level—what biodiversity is, how it works, and why it is the most important tool in our battle against climate change. Antonelli offers recommendations for large-scale political changes, as well as smaller, practical steps that readers can implement in their own lives and homes. With Antonelli as our guide, The Hidden Universe helps us imagine a future where biodiversity is not just preserved but cherished.

front cover of How Nature Speaks
How Nature Speaks
The Dynamics of the Human Ecological Condition
Yrjö Haila and Chuck Dyke, eds.
Duke University Press, 2006
How Nature Speaks illustrates the convergence of complexity theory in the biophysical and social sciences and the implications of the science of complexity for environmental politics and practice. This collection of essays focuses on uncertainty, surprise, and positionality—situated rather than absolute knowledge—in studies of nature by people embedded within the very thing they purport to study from the outside. The contributors address the complicated relationship between scientists and nature as part of a broader reassessment of how we conceive of ourselves, knowledge, and the world that we both inhabit and shape.

Exploring ways of conceiving the complexity and multiplicity of humans’ many interactive relationships with the environment, the contributors provide in-depth case studies of the interweaving of culture and nature in socio-historical processes. The case studies focus on the origin of environmental movements, the politicization of environmental issues in city politics, the development of a local energy production system, and the convergence of forest management practices toward a dominant scheme. They are supported by explorations of big-picture issues: recurring themes in studies of social and environmental dynamics, the difficulties of deliberative democracy, and the potential gains for socio-ecological research offered by developmental systems theory and Pierre Bourdieu’s theory of intentionality.

How Nature Speaks includes a helpful primer, “On Thinking Dynamically about the Human Ecological Condition,” which explains the basic principles of complexity and nonlinear thinking.

front cover of Human Impact on Ancient Environments
Human Impact on Ancient Environments
Charles L. Redman
University of Arizona Press, 1999
Threats to biodiversity, food shortages, urban sprawl . . . lessons for environmental problems that confront us today may well be found in the past. The archaeological record contains hundreds of situations in which societies developed long-term sustainable relationships with their environments—and thousands in which the relationships were destructive. Charles Redman demonstrates that much can be learned from an improved understanding of peoples who, through seemingly rational decisions, degraded their environments and threatened their own survival. By discussing archaeological case studies from around the world—from the deforestation of the Mayan lowlands to soil erosion in ancient Greece to the almost total depletion of resources on Easter Island—Redman reveals the long-range coevolution of culture and environment and clearly shows the impact that ancient peoples had on their world. These case studies focus on four themes: habitat transformation and animal extinctions, agricultural practices, urban growth, and the forces that accompany complex society. They show that humankind's commitment to agriculture has had cultural consequences that have conditioned our perception of the environment and reveal that societies before European contact did not necessarily live the utopian existences that have been popularly supposed. Whereas most books on this topic tend to treat human societies as mere reactors to environmental stimuli, Redman's volume shows them to be active participants in complex and evolving ecological relationships. Human Impact on Ancient Environments demonstrates how archaeological research can provide unique insights into the nature of human stewardship of the Earth and can permanently alter the way we think about humans and the environment.
